|
|
1e0f2017f6
|
Fixed static function trait
|
2023-08-23 08:39:10 +01:00 |
|
|
|
cd12ac72c7
|
Fixed Info column filter
|
2023-07-25 16:47:42 +01:00 |
|
|
|
0f5140d01f
|
Simplified the organisation column permissions for now
|
2023-07-18 13:29:34 +01:00 |
|
|
|
85b1cec060
|
Added a has_organisation authorizer check
|
2023-07-18 13:28:50 +01:00 |
|
|
|
522718f7ee
|
Re-built organisation permissions
|
2023-06-07 13:41:14 +01:00 |
|
|
|
fe03ad58af
|
Removed namespace that is not used
|
2023-06-07 13:29:11 +01:00 |
|
|
|
577ebd0377
|
Fix findUnique issues
|
2023-06-07 13:28:58 +01:00 |
|
|
|
58a1b2d316
|
No longer need to override authorization manager
|
2023-06-07 11:12:32 +01:00 |
|
|
|
de85fd6e47
|
Replaced "can_admin_via_orgs" auth check & added an explicit flag to the members check
|
2023-06-06 15:52:54 +01:00 |
|
|
|
85175f2ead
|
Show/hide columns programatically
|
2023-06-06 15:51:06 +01:00 |
|
|
|
b7d15dc25e
|
Removed hasRole twig function
|
2023-06-06 15:48:53 +01:00 |
|
|
|
3d21ab4950
|
Removed token logger service
|
2023-06-06 15:48:37 +01:00 |
|
|
|
cbf6b916c3
|
Moved the BasicTokenRepository code to UFTweaks
|
2023-06-06 15:08:31 +01:00 |
|
|
|
c99a277e2a
|
Added an administrator fallback banner to organisation join approval emails
|
2022-11-14 16:54:52 +00:00 |
|
|
|
5a0906eb43
|
Organisation admins can view the user pages of their members
|
2022-05-19 16:45:13 +01:00 |
|
|
|
a820fb56e0
|
Moved auditer into a sprinkle of it's own
|
2022-05-19 16:44:21 +01:00 |
|
|
|
cf5247aa66
|
Fix filtering of name/description (case in-sensitive)
|
2022-03-15 12:18:13 +00:00 |
|
|
|
1fe9cba239
|
Fixed nesting of sprunje where clause
|
2022-03-15 12:17:40 +00:00 |
|
|
|
05942afd61
|
Fixed permission for editing name of organisation
|
2022-03-08 16:52:51 +00:00 |
|
|
|
a07ec92546
|
Join requests now present an "are you sure?" modal
|
2022-03-08 16:11:09 +00:00 |
|
|
|
52b5a880b2
|
Added some extra checks to ensure the user is not already in the organisation they are attempting to join
|
2022-03-08 15:35:22 +00:00 |
|
|
|
340413ff38
|
Allow editable fields to be selected by permission
|
2022-03-08 15:16:54 +00:00 |
|
|
|
cd5afda21b
|
Don't run the default permissions seed (it wipes existing permissions)
|
2022-03-08 15:04:55 +00:00 |
|
|
|
012b633eaf
|
Update the dashboard with an organisations widget
|
2022-03-07 16:27:52 +00:00 |
|
|
|
2005a17eef
|
Corrected spelling of permission
|
2022-03-07 12:34:54 +00:00 |
|
|
|
5e6c66df3c
|
Further permission tweaks
|
2022-03-07 12:13:28 +00:00 |
|
|
|
7206bfc851
|
Tweaks to permissions
|
2022-03-07 12:06:41 +00:00 |
|
|
|
d98d6ddd1b
|
Fix a permission bug
|
2022-03-07 11:16:01 +00:00 |
|
|
|
ab530e71a1
|
Switch to using a trait to hold the user organisation stuff
|
2022-03-05 17:26:23 +00:00 |
|
|
|
8d0d097f15
|
Remove phone numbers from org permissions (not in this branch)
|
2022-03-02 15:43:16 +00:00 |
|
|
|
f210f4d101
|
Allow approving/denying organisations without tokens (admin override)
|
2022-03-02 15:35:39 +00:00 |
|
|
|
868cd1a9ae
|
Fixed some more permissions
|
2022-03-02 15:35:08 +00:00 |
|
|
|
9a0fc3f3bd
|
Fixed promotion/demotion permission check
|
2022-03-02 15:34:39 +00:00 |
|
|
|
be0ae74431
|
Fix postgresql DISTINCT problems
|
2022-03-02 09:46:20 +00:00 |
|
|
|
d6f134e1e9
|
Organisation admins can now promote/demote members/admins
|
2022-03-01 14:59:56 +00:00 |
|
|
|
6b7e7cd53b
|
Fixed "remove member" bug
|
2022-02-28 11:31:07 +00:00 |
|
|
|
001559ed12
|
Previous method didn't work, use new method
|
2022-02-28 11:19:16 +00:00 |
|
|
|
1c4a71410d
|
Allow manual override of accept/reject when there are no valid tokens (check to make sure this doesn't cause issues elsewhere...)
|
2022-02-28 11:15:02 +00:00 |
|
|
|
2fe8c7fd16
|
Fixed dependency
|
2022-02-28 10:24:53 +00:00 |
|
|
|
0dbfbef594
|
Added capability for organisation administrators to accept/reject join requests, remove members, edit their details and reset their passwords
|
2022-02-22 18:11:59 +00:00 |
|
|
|
5456902f77
|
Beta version of migration scripts
|
2022-02-22 16:40:39 +00:00 |
|
|
|
f75bde0ccf
|
Sorting by organisation on the users page is a bit broken because of the way the join is done so don't offer the capability to do it in the first place...
|
2022-02-22 13:53:26 +00:00 |
|
|
|
96e861e7fe
|
Hide some administration columns for basic organisation users (Fixes #3)
|
2022-02-22 13:52:53 +00:00 |
|
|
|
0d5551f927
|
Fix the user-manage-organisations modal (column name & search)
|
2022-02-22 13:48:20 +00:00 |
|
|
|
be8404c9a5
|
Split pending organisations into a separate list and default to only returning organisations a user is an accepted member of (Fixes #1)
|
2022-02-22 13:47:44 +00:00 |
|
|
|
e825050814
|
Fixed incorrect counts due to the left-join
|
2022-02-22 13:18:23 +00:00 |
|
|
|
e62e71ab6c
|
Fix page redirect after changing an organisation name (slug) from the organisation info page (Fixes #9)
|
2022-02-22 11:43:48 +00:00 |
|
|
|
e92b80fbe1
|
Prevent users from creating more than 1 or being a member of more than 1 organisation in single organisation configuration (Fixes #7)
|
2022-02-22 11:02:16 +00:00 |
|
|
|
db19560e45
|
Fixes #2
|
2022-02-22 10:44:42 +00:00 |
|
|
|
940d5b0d2f
|
Fixed postgres complaint about integer = boolean comparison (I hope!)
|
2022-02-21 17:54:33 +00:00 |
|